obsessed xx: Totally Enormous Extinct Dinosaurs “Tapes & Money”

I am obsessed with TEED. I love everything I’ve heard from him so far, so much that it pains me to try to pick a favorite. But for right now, this song might be it. Tapes & Money is his new single and will be available two days before my birthday (quite good timing!) April 2nd. He is currently on tour, so make sure you check him out for me if you get the chance! If you do by chance find yourself having a chat with him, tell him to come to the US so I can see him live too.

Totally Enormous Extinct Dinosaurs Tour:

Leave a Reply